You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

怎样连接云虚拟主机的数据库-火山引擎

基于云平台的即开即用、稳定可靠、灵活弹性、易于使用的关系型数据库服务

云服务器共享型1核2G

超强性价比,适合个人、测试等场景使用
9.90/101.00/月
新客专享限购1台

云防火墙高级版

网站安全防护,访问关系可视,高可靠性
120.00/200.00/月
新客专享限购1台限时6折

云安全中心高级版

安全防护与管理,保护云主机和容器安全
36.00/60.00/月
新客专享限购1台限时6折

域名注册服务

com/cn热门域名1元起,实名认证即享
1.00/首年起66.00/首年起
新客专享限购1个

怎样连接云虚拟主机的数据库-相关文档

连接云虚拟主机的数据库是现代网站开发的一个重要部分,掌握这个技能可以让我们更好的管理和维护数据库。本文将介绍通过PHP代码连接云虚拟主机的数据库的步骤。

一、创建数据库和用户

在连接云虚拟主机的数据库之前,需要先创建相应的数据库和用户,并将用户赋予对该数据库的访问权限。一般情况下,我们可以通过虚拟主机面板进行创建,也可以通过SSH访问云服务器进行创建。此处以cPanel面板为例,创建数据库和用户的步骤如下:

  1. 登录cPanel面板,并找到“MySQL 数据库”图标。
  2. 在“新建数据库”中输入数据库名称,并点击“创建数据库”按钮。
  3. 在“添加新用户”中输入用户名和密码,并点击“创建用户”按钮。
  4. 在“添加用户到数据库”中选择刚刚创建的数据库和用户,并点击“添加”按钮。
  5. 在“设置用户权限”中将所需权限勾选上,并点击“制定更改”按钮。

二、编写PHP代码连接数据库

在创建完数据库和用户之后,就可以通过PHP代码连接数据库了。在PHP中,可以通过mysqli函数库或PDO扩展来连接数据库。下面分别介绍这两种方式的使用方法。

  1. mysqli函数库的使用方法:

<?php $host = 'localhost'; //主机地址 $user = '数据库用户名'; //数据库用户名 $pwd = '数据库密码'; //数据库密码 $dbname = '数据库名称'; //数据库名称

// 连接数据库 $conn = new mysqli($host, $user, $pwd, $dbname);

// 检查连接是否成功 if ($conn->connect_error) { die("连接失败: " . $conn->connect_error); }

echo "连接成功";

// 关闭连接 $conn->close(); ?>

  1. PDO扩展的使用方法:

<?php $host = 'localhost'; //主机地址 $user = '数据库用户名'; //数据库用户名 $pwd = '数据库密码'; //数据库密码 $dbname = '数据库名称'; //数据库名称

// 连接数据库 try { $conn = new PDO("mysql:host=$host;dbname=$dbname", $user, $pwd); // 设置 PDO 错误模式为异常 $con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。

怎样连接云虚拟主机的数据库-优选内容

约束与限制
购买云数据库 veDB MySQL 版产品系列后,您不需要做数据库的基础运维(如高可用、打安全补丁等),但为了提高实例的稳定性和安全性,在使用上有一些固定限制。本文为您介绍云数据库 veDB MySQL 版的相关使用限制。 约束... 数据库管理、白名单管理等。 数据库访问 如果实例未开通公网访问,则该实例必须与云主机弹性云服务器处在同一个虚拟私有云子网内才能相互访问。实例的默认端口为 3306,暂不支持修改。 备份查看 实例的备份文件存放在...
约束与限制
数据库创建 支持以命令行方式创建数据库,但是若含有除下划线(_)或中划线(-)以外的特殊字符(如!@$%^&*()+=等),则不支持在控制台进行数据库授权和删除操作。 数据库备份 仅支持通过控制台或 API 进行物理备份。 数据... 数据库访问 如果实例未开通公网访问,则该实例必须与云主机弹性云服务器处在同一个虚拟私有云子网内才能相互访问。实例的默认端口为 3306 ,支持修改,更多详情请参见修改私网访问地址端口。 备份查看 实例的备份文件...
基础使用
点击 EMR 集群节点 (emr-master-1主机名称)的 ECS ID,跳转进入到服务器的实例界面,点击右上角的 远程连接 按钮,输入集群创建时的 root 密码,进入远程终端。 Master 节点机器上已经安装了 MySQL 客户端, 可以通... 后续登录时即可通过如下连接命令登录: mysql -h 127.0.0.1 -P9030 -u test_user -ptest_user_passwd新创建的普通用户默认没有任何权限。 3.2 创建数据库 初始可通过 root用户创建数据库,命令如下: CREATE DATABASE...
实例FAQ
如何安装/卸载GPU驱动? 成功创建实例后,为什么在实例列表页面找不到该实例? 创建实例时,为什么无法选择已创建的子网? 创建实例时,为什么无法选择已创建的安全组? 登录与连接问题 登录实例需要放通什么端口? 通过... 如何迁移Linux系统盘中的数据? 如何把本地数据上传到服务器ECS上? 使用问题 包年包月实例支持删除操作吗? 实例删除后可以恢复吗? 如何查看已删除实例的信息? 云服务器默认提供数据库吗? 云服务器支持安装虚拟机...

怎样连接云虚拟主机的数据库-相关内容

Clickhouse数据连接
1. 产品概述 支持Clickhouse数据连接。 说明 在连接数据库之前,请明确以下信息: 数据库所在服务器的 IP 地址和端口号; 数据库的用户名和密码; 需要连接的数据库方式。 需要将以下IP设置为出口白名单后,方可在Saas... 在数据连接目录左上角,点击 新建数据连接 按钮,选择 Clickhouse 。 填写所需的基本信息,并进行 测试连接 。 名称 描述 服务器 部署ClickHouse数据库主机的公网地址,此时的公网地址为主机IP地址。 端口 部署ClickHo...
如何排查连接 Redis 实例出现 UnknownHostException 的问题
连接云数据库 Redis 实例时,如果因 DNS 服务出现问题导致 ECS 解析连接地址失败,ECS 与 Redis 之间的网络连接将会中断。本文将介绍如何排查连接 Redis 实例出现的 UnknownHostException 问题。# 问题分析ECS 与 Redis 之间出现连接问题的原因多种多样,DNS 解析失败是其中较为常见的一种。当出现 UnknownHostException 或者 failed to connect: redis-XXXXXXX.redis.ivolces.com could not be resolved 之类提示未知主机名或...
同步至火山引擎版 ElasticSearch
自建数据库所属的本地网络已通过 VPN 网关接入火山引擎。详细操作,请参见搭建上 VPC 与云下多数据中心网络互通。 在需要使用专线实现数据迁移时,您需要搭建云上单私有网络和云下单数据中心网络连通的专线连接。... 项目是一个虚拟的概念,包括一组资源、用户和角色。通过项目可以对一组资源进行统一的查看和管理,并且控制项目内用户和角色对这些资源的权限。 ::: 同步拓扑 根据业务需要选择同步拓扑,当前仅支持单向同...
同步至火山引擎版 ElasticSearch
请参见创建 RDS MySQL 实例和创建数据库。 已创建搜索服务实例和设置默认用户名 admin 的密码。详细信息,请参见创建 ElasticSearch 实例。 当源库部署在 IDC 或 ECS 中,且通过公网连接,您需要将 DTS 的服务器 ... 项目是一个虚拟的概念,包括一组资源、用户和角色。通过项目可以对一组资源进行统一的查看和管理,并且控制项目内用户和角色对这些资源的权限。 ::: 同步拓扑 根据业务需要选择同步拓扑,当前仅支持单向同...
同步至公网自建 ElasticSearch
自建数据库所属的本地网络已通过 VPN 网关接入火山引擎。详细操作,请参见搭建上 VPC 与云下多数据中心网络互通。 在需要使用专线实现数据迁移时,您需要搭建云上单私有网络和云下单数据中心网络连通的专线连接。... 项目是一个虚拟的概念,包括一组资源、用户和角色。通过项目可以对一组资源进行统一的查看和管理,并且控制项目内用户和角色对这些资源的权限。 ::: 同步拓扑 根据业务需要选择同步拓扑,当前仅支持单向同...
(邀测)迁移至火山引擎版 Redis
自建数据库所属的本地网络已通过 VPN 网关接入火山引擎。详细操作,请参见搭建上VPC与云下多数据中心网络互通。 在需要使用专线实现数据迁移时,您需要搭建云上单私有网络和云下单数据中心网络连通的专线连接。详... 项目是一个虚拟的概念,包括一组资源、用户和角色。通过项目可以对一组资源进行统一的查看和管理,并且控制项目内用户和角色对这些资源的权限。 计费方式 当前仅支持按量计费,您无需选择。 说明 关于计费的详细信...
创建实例
创建实例是使用云数据库 veDB MySQL 版的第一步。本文介绍如何创建 veDB MySQL 实例。 前提条件 已注册火山引擎账号,并完成企业实名认证。账号注册和实名认证的方法,请参见如何进行账号注册和实名认证。 已完成私有... 否则它们无法通过内网连接,只能通过外网连接,无法发挥最佳性能。 主实例节点数量 每个 veDB MySQL 实例支持 2~16 个节点,至少选择两个节点保障集群高可用(一主一只读)。 说明 如果主节点故障,系统会自动将只读节...
一键开启云上增长新空间
一键开启云上增长新空间
一键开启云上增长新空间